Subject: [PATCH 0/3] Add HwSpinlock support for TI K3 SoCs
Date: Thu, 30 May 2019 21:13:18 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190531021321.14025-1-s-anna@ti.com> (raw)

Hi Bjorn,

The following series adds the support for the HwSpinlock IP present
on the newer TI K3 AM65x and J721E SoCs. The first 2 patches are
related to the K3 support, and the last patch is a minor debug related
trace to see the number of locks registered on each SoC.

I will be posting the DT nodes once the binding is acked.

regards
Suman

Suman Anna (3):
  dt-bindings: hwlock: Update OMAP binding for TI K3 SoCs
  hwspinlock/omap: Add support for TI K3 SoCs
  hwspinlock/omap: Add a trace during probe

 .../bindings/hwlock/omap-hwspinlock.txt       | 25 +++++++++++++++----
 drivers/hwspinlock/Kconfig                    |  2 +-
 drivers/hwspinlock/omap_hwspinlock.c          |  4 +++
 3 files changed, 25 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
